Former Botafogo defender Bolívar has praised the work of manager Vagner Mancini as his old side attempt to avoid relegation to the Campeonato Brasileiro Série B.

Bolívar, who has only recently departed the club after he and three other senior players had a dispute with Botafogo’s chairman (which ended up in their dismissal), has come out in support of current manager Mancini, and unsurprisingly suggested the board would not be blameless should the club be relegated.

Mancini has faced numerous problems since taking charge at the Fogão in April, with injuries and big financial troubles affecting his side along with the aforementioned departure of key players.

Botafogo currently occupy a relegation place, sitting 17th in Serie A after 31 rounds, but the Maracanã based side are only one point off safety, a position currently held by Vitoria, and Bolívar belives Mancini has done a good job so far, as reported by lancenet:

“Mancini has been a key guy. He is very energetic. He’s a guy who is going through the same difficulty of the players, and he has lost four key men… It’s hard.”

Botafogo face a tough task away at league leaders Cruzeiro on Sunday as they continue their bid to avoid the drop.
